
Kenjirō Tsuda, born in 1971, works in Japan as an actor and voice performer who also directs films, represented by the ANDSTIR agency. In Bleach, produced by Studio Pierrot, he voices the scheming noble Tokinada Tsunayashiro.
Tsuda plays Tokinada Tsunayashiro, a manipulative noble antagonist introduced during the Thousand-Year Blood War arc. His low, controlled delivery suits a character who hides calculated ambition behind an air of aristocratic civility, and the casting drew on his reputation for cool, commanding villain roles.
Active since the mid-1990s, Tsuda has become one of anime's most recognizable voices, known for parts such as Reiner Braun in Attack on Titan, Giorno Giovanna in JoJo's Bizarre Adventure: Golden Wind, and Kokushibo in Demon Slayer. Alongside his acting, he has also directed live-action film projects.
